Cotton fibre is picked cleaned, sorted, made into a ribbon like parallel arrangement called sliver which is stretched and then twisted to form yarn, this yarn is then combined to form fabric. The first step is called spinning or yarn manufacture. The second step is called weaving/knitting or fabric manufacture.

Cotton fibre is natural fibre. The cotton plant bears fruits called as cotton bolls. The bolls are full of seeds and cotton fibre.

*Cotton bolls ripe and open to expose cotton. The collection of cotton bolls is done by hand picking.

*Cotton bolls are separated from the seeds by combing them. This is known as ginning.

*Cotton collected after ginning is in the form of fibres.

*Cotton yarn is made from cotton fibres.

*Yarn is spun on charka to make cotton thred.

*Cotton threads dyed with colours by the proces of dyeing.

*Dyed threads are wound on reels by the process of reeling.

*Reeled threads are woven into cloth by the process of weaving.

*Weaving is the process of arranging two sets of yarns together perpendicular to each other to make a fabric. Fabrics are woven on looms. These looms may be operated by power or by hand
